Transaction 75c915b34d2a4f32e2e3a5dbc80e992e8b69289e69529a44533d47f8cfcf409e
1 Input
1 Output
-
75c915b34d2a4f32e2e3a5dbc80e992e8b69289e69529a44533d47f8cfcf409e:0
- value
- 508088
- script pubkey
- OP_0 OP_PUSHBYTES_20 2626af04afd88f71fb1d503e322ca3fb0fcb1599
- address
- bc1qycn27p90mz8hr7ca2qlryt9rlv8uk9ve6z4tfy